Tortoise husband of salamander, Childless couple for sorrowful years, Their quest for child was beyond placation; What is matrimony without fertility? Child is gold,child is the crown on our heads, Child is the retain wall that holds us to life. So tortoise consulted goddess of fertility Her divinity prescribed goddess soup for her: Fresh tomato,fresh paprika,olive oil,curry ; Chicken,cow liver ,young lamb flesh , Tomorrow tortoise must collect the soup. The tortoise,the soup and the priest: Take the soup to salamander for fruition, Behold thou must not taste of it; He collected the soup and headed home, On his way home the soup was scenting, His gluttony at last consumed his will. In a blink of eye,his stomach swelled up, The pain of edema hit him everywhere, His eyes became red like cherry fruit; What could I do? Regret took its place, Restlessly tortoise returned to shrine. At shrine he pleaded with goddess: Ho priest I have come to beg,selah; The soup you cooked for her,selah ; You said I should not eat from it,selah; The thicket on my path fell me down,selah; My hand touched the ground and touched my mouth; I looked at my stomach,it had become balloo; Oh priest I have come to beg,selah. Like thunder a voice spoke to him: Words of goddess like arrow had left the bow, Remember the pillar of salt in the days of Lot, The wage of disobedience forever stands.
